Super sleeping bag - review after >1yr of use!
I slept in this during the week for 14months straight. I was in a small tent in the UK. I experienced snow, rain, winds and a balmy summer - typical of English weather. The bag performed really very well - I was always warm enough and had some of the best sleeps of my life. It did get wet/damp a couple of times but easily dried out. Zip always worked fine. Not one fault.

Nice piece of kit
Haven't used it yet apart from checking I fit in it, I'm 6'2" and the large bag has more room than many other I've had. Repacking into the stuff sack is awkward I'll need a few practices before I try this out on a mountain side. Can't fault it for quality. I'll update in a few weeks if I get a chance to escape the city for a few nights.** quick update, first use went well the sleeping bag is perfect for me. I've thrown the stuff sac/compression bag in the bin. it takes way too long to get it in there I've substituted a large lightweight dry bag for it. dry bag takes 30 seconds to fill, another 30 seconds to get all the air out and it packs smaller than the compression bag.

Good bag for the price
I got the bag back in June of 2018 and only used it twice over the last week as it was not cold enough (October 2018) once in a bivi and once in a tent, I found the bive compressed the bag and stopped it from lofting so it was not as warm as it could be, last night I was in my tent and it dipped to about -3c -10c with the wind chill and the bag keep me nice and warm I only wore a pair of shorts, the outside of the tent was covered in forest in the morning. I am 196cm tall and 90kg and got the large bag and have plenty of room I can completely seal myself in and still haveroom to move.The only issue I have with the bag is the stitching is fairly poor quality in some parts and is starting to freay only after using it twice like all sleeping bags I store it out of it's stuff sack.

Not as warm as I had hoped.
I bought this and used it for a night in the open on a charity rough sleep. Temp outside was 0C and I had a thermal base mat. I also had some decent thermal vest and bottoms on and I was still cold. This is supposed to be rated to -10C and I didn’t really feel that it was doing the job. I think this is an autumn and spring bag but not sure if I can endorse this as a Winter bag. Hope this helps.
